Mrs. Kelly had an appointment to see the doctor for a persistent lowgrade fever. During the visit she mentioned that she had twisted her ankle a week or so ago and that it still hurt when she put weight on it. The doctor took xrays and found that there was a stress fracture. He gave her a postop shoe to wear to provide more support and reduce her pain. When coding this patient’s visit, he used fever for the diagnosis code, and he used xrays and a postop shoe for the procedure codes. What error did the doctor make when coding?

Explanation / Answer

The doctor gave diagnosis code for fever (ICD-9-CM coding manual; diagnosis code: 780.60) and procedure code for stress fracture in her ankle (ICD-10-CM Diagnosis Code M84.373 for unspecified ankle). The diagnosis is inconsistent with the procedure.
